Are you considering a career path that is both impactful and growing? Medical coding might be the perfect solution for you. This essential field plays a vital role in the healthcare industry by mapping medical diagnoses and procedures into standardized codes. These codes are then employed for billing, insurance claims, and valuable clinical data analysis.

Many factors should be considered when evaluating an online medical coding course. The reputation of the program, the experience of the instructors, and the syllabus are all significant considerations. Additionally, look for courses that offer hands-on training and support throughout your learning journey.
